Pro-Vice-Chancellor Professor Chris Rudd visits UNNC
Professor Chris Rudd, Pro-Vice-Chancellor of the University of Nottingham visited the Nottingham Ningbo Campus from 19 to 23 September 2008. Personally carrying out research in the area of composite materials manufacture, he recognises the importance of sustainability within the manufacturing domain.
I was very happy to join Professor Rudd visiting a range of research institutions and industrial companies in and around Ningbo on Monday 22/09/2008 (see below for a programme overview). I was very impressed by the existing facilities, even more so by the envisioned developments. During the meetings with the Chinese partners it became clear that they consider sustainability as an important aspect of their progress.
In the early evening I had the chance to discuss our research activities within sustainable manufacturing with Professor Rudd, giving me some very constructive feedback and good ideas.
